### Hyper-V基础结构学习手册知识点概述
#### 一、Hyper-V简介与基础结构
- **Hyper-V概述**:Hyper-V是Microsoft开发的一款企业级虚拟化平台,能够在Windows Server上创建和运行虚拟机(VM),从而实现对计算资源的有效利用和灵活管理。
- **Hyper-V基础结构**:这一部分详细介绍了Hyper-V的基础结构,包括硬件需求、系统要求以及虚拟化环境的构建方法。
#### 二、硬件需求
- **处理器**:
- 必须是64位多插槽多核处理器;
- 支持虚拟化硬件辅助功能,如AMD-V或Intel VT-x;
- 数据执行保护(DEP)功能,例如AMD的NX位或Intel的XD位;
- 支持二级地址转换(SLAT)技术,如AMD的NPT/RVI或Intel的EPT。
- **存储**:
- 至少40GB的本地RAID1或RAID10硬盘空间用于操作系统分区。
- **内存**:
- 最小2GB RAM。
- **其他硬件**:
- 所有硬件组件必须具备Windows Server标识,并支持群集功能。
#### 三、NUMA(非统一内存访问)
- **NUMA概念**:NUMA是一种内存架构,在该架构下,内存访问时间取决于内存与处理器之间的距离。
- **主机NUMA**:
- 主机通过将内核和内存划分为“节点”来优化性能。
- 在同一NUMA节点内分配内存和线程可以减少延迟。
- **来宾客户NUMA**:
- 在虚拟机内部表示NUMA拓扑结构。
- 来宾操作系统能够做出关于线程和内存分配的智能决策。
- 来宾客户的NUMA节点与主机资源相匹配。
#### 四、Hyper-V版本对比
- **Windows Server 2008**:
- 支持最多16个逻辑处理器;
- 最大物理内存为1TB;
- 支持实时迁移,但一次只能迁移一个虚拟机。
- **Windows Server 2008 R2**:
- 与2008相比,最大支持64个逻辑处理器;
- 其他规格相似。
- **Windows Server 2012**:
- 最大支持320个逻辑处理器;
- 最大物理内存提高至4TB;
- 支持不限数量的实时迁移;
- 支持不限数量的实时存储迁移。
#### 五、管理与配置
- **配置与部署工具**:Hyper-V提供了多种工具用于配置和部署虚拟化环境,包括PowerShell命令、Hyper-V Manager等。
- **启用Hyper-V**:通过服务器管理器或其他管理工具启用Hyper-V角色。
- **Microsoft Hyper-V Server 2012**:专门的Hyper-V服务器版本,提供更高效的虚拟化服务。
#### 六、Hyper-V高可用性与实时迁移
- **高可用性**:通过群集等功能提高系统的可靠性和可用性。
- **实时迁移**:实现在不同物理主机之间无缝迁移运行中的虚拟机,以实现负载平衡或维护操作。
#### 七、Hyper-V网络
- **网络配置**:设置虚拟网络接口卡(vNIC)以连接到物理网络。
- **高级网络功能**:如虚拟交换机、网络虚拟化等。
#### 八、Hyper-V存储
- **存储配置**:包括使用共享存储、快照、复制等功能。
- **存储优化**:利用存储QoS等技术提高存储效率。
#### 九、与System Center 2012集成
- **Virtual Machine Manager**:通过VMM实现对Hyper-V集群的集中管理和自动化部署。
- **与其他System Center 2012组件集成**:如Operation Manager用于监控,Data Protection Manager用于备份等。
#### 十、总结
- Hyper-V作为一款强大的虚拟化平台,为企业提供了高度灵活和可扩展的解决方案。
- 通过对Hyper-V的理解和掌握,IT专业人士能够更好地设计、实施和管理复杂的虚拟化环境,从而提高资源利用率并降低成本。